Tendering for Projects (Understanding the Process)

Overview

Winning contracts is essential to the continuing viability of any contractor. 

It involves not only effective estimation skills and understanding of the issues and requirements of the procurement stage but also the skills and ability to structure the tender not just to be successful but to increase profits as well. 

If you wish to learn the tendering process, then this course is a must.

In addition it is essential for Clients and Consulting Engineers to understand how a tender is structured and presented to ensure competent evaluation of tenders submitted by Contractors.

Topics include

  • Types of contracts (lump sum, measure and value etc)
  • Tender planning
  • Material labour, plant and subcontractor unit costs
  • Where to price P & G costs, overheads and risks
  • Pricing strategies
  • Extras and variations
  • Weighting of unit rates
  • Preliminary and General (P & G) cost (time related and fixed)
  • How to calculate on-site overhead and profit percentages and rate per working day
  • Front-end loading of tenders
  • Alternative tenders

On completion of this course participants will

  • Understand the purposes, types and methods of tendering
  • Prepare a well-balanced tender and unbalanced tender
  • Learn a process to achieve consistency in tendering
  • Identify where the potential for winning a job may be
  • Differentiate between fixed and time related P & G
  • Significance of extension of time under NZS3910:2003.
